I support parents in understanding that children’s behavior is often an expression of unmet needs rather than something to control or correct. Instead of relying on discipline alone, we work on strengthening connection, responding to emotions with presence and understanding, and maintaining parental leadership through relationship rather than force. An important part of this work also involves parents becoming more aware of their own patterns, so they can show up in a more grounded and connected way with their children.
